About Koro

At this moment, there are two bands, known as "Koro" (actually, one of them called "KorO", with big "O")

The first one - Koro from Knoxville, Tennessee, and existed from 1982 to 1984. The band might have been forgotten if not for a remarkable self-released 8 song 7", recorded in 1983.

The 7" has been bootlegged twice, once in small quantities with a cover similar to the original, and once recently with a different cover and lyrics.

They gained their name from a psychiatric syndrome found mainly in China. The syndrome involves patients, typically 35-40 years old, suddenly becomes worried that their penis will somehow disappear into their abdomen and that they will die.

"Skin-ripping thrash chock full of blistering spasms that detonate this Tennessee invasion in the vein of CAUSE FOR ALARM or D.R.I. KORO thrust a powerful convulsion of firing speed and rapid guitar screaming which swirls in furious catapults of overall chaos. This scorcher is hard to find."
-Pushead, from MRR, 1984

The second one is an alternative band KorO from Kyiv, Ukraine.

Style: rock, alternative, post-punk, new-wave.

Oleg Korsun - Vocals, Guitars
Ivan Shapkin - Back vocals, Guitars, Bass, Keyboards, Programming

The idea of this mutual music project was born quite a long time ago (in the beginning of 2007) when the members were both a part of Nowhereland group and felt that they wanted to create a little bit different music. After Ivan Shapkin had quitted his collaboration with Nowhereland in March 2007, started the project. But in fact Oleg Korsun’s taking part in Nowhereland did not leave much time for work. In summer 2008 when other musicians of Nowhereland left the group, Oleg decided to cancel Nowhereland project and started to work with Ivan Shapkin on KorO project only.
At the moment KorO in the process of recording our debut album which is going to be released in the year 2009.
